Output 31b227ea65a45fa1f603294f9ff26b71be19ebc1912eb42cbfde5ba2139a325a:1
- value
- 1415943484
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8d5f9ecda63191af258abf23a9e471e02ce2ab3 OP_EQUAL
- address
- 3MTYDJzZGB3AXzngyP7JE6hmBLRiDTKFKt
- transaction
- 31b227ea65a45fa1f603294f9ff26b71be19ebc1912eb42cbfde5ba2139a325a
- confirmations
- 561976
- spent
- true